You want to put a few drops of the ammonia in your tank to bring your ammonia up to 4ppm. You want to keep checking it and dosing it back up to 4ppm every 24 hours until your bacteria can convert 4ppm of ammonia to 0 and also have 0ppm of Nitrites in that 24 hour period. NitrAtes are irrelevant until that point. This guide that eco23 put together is outstanding:
